1. Method for producing gramophone records by injection moulding, comprising:
heating polymeric material to liquefy said material, said polymeric material is polyethylene terephthalate isophthalic acid modified copolymer;
supplying liquid polymeric material (2) under pressure by one single injection nozzle (11), into a space (7) between two moulding mould parts (3, 5) through a single passage (12) located in one of the mould parts (5) wherein said two moulding mould parts (3, 5) are disposed at a distance between 1 and 5 mm from each other;
immediately after injection of the liquid polymeric material the mould parts are moved against each other creating a mould cavity having a shape of a gramophone record;
wherein said injection nozzle (11) is provided with a nozzle piece (31) and an inlet opening (33) and a pouring channel (35) extending between said inlet opening (33) and said nozzle piece (31) such that the liquid polymeric material is provided with a single stream from the inlet opening (33) into the space (7) and does not split into sub-streams, and wherein said liquid polymeric material is supplied in a direction perpendicular to the moulding surfaces of the mould parts.
